Log in to Your MyChart Account How to Log in to MyChart Web Browser: In your web browser, enter the address of your healthcare organization's MyChart website and access the login page Enter your MyChart username and password, and click Sign In Mobile App: Download the MyChart mobile app from the Google Play Store (for Android) or the App Store (for Apple iOS)
